Machined Parts Finisher Our client, a successful manufacturing business close to Norwich, are currently seeking a Machinist Parts Finisher to join their team.This role is Monday - Friday 8:30am - 5:00pm, due to seasonal variations these hours can be variable.Key Responsibilities:

  • Complete the finishing process of all machined components to an agreed quality level to ensure that they are ready for production assembly where applicable. This will include deburring, filing, sanding, staining and grinding the cut edges for materialsleaving the machine shop, utilising various hand held tools. Cut and groove extrusions utilising the circular saw or hand held router
  • Ensure finished parts are grouped together and suitably labelled for the next process; painting, fabrication or assembly
  • Ensure a high standard of quality production with continuous improvement, reporting any problems or potential problems to your immediate supervisor
  • Liaise with the Machine Shop Department Leader, or in their absence with the production and engineering office personnel, to organise and implement work schedules to ensure the timely completion of all orders
  • Ensure that the working area is kept clean and tidy ready to carry out the next task
  • Train to be able to carry out the maximum range of tasks, for which they are capable, within the machining / finishing department, and co-operate in a culture of job rotation
  • Comply with all aspects of the Health and Safety procedures at all times, ensuring any concerns are brought to the attention of your immediate supervisor without delay
  • Ensure that all defined personal protection equipment is utilised within the machine shop area or for the safe use of hand held tools e.g. hand routers, grinders, etc
The ideal candidate will be methodical and logical with a basic engineering aptitude from a background within wood or metal work.For further details regarding this exciting opportunity please forward a copy of your CV today!Todd Hayes Ltd is an equal opportunities employer.
